Translated Labs
YOU SAID:
I love to play xbox live
INTO JAPANESE
Xbox Liveをプレイするのが大好き
BACK INTO ENGLISH
I love playing Xbox Live
Xbox Liveのプレイが大好き
Yes! You've got it man! You've got it